    NP : THE EMI YEARS : 1957 - 1960 - John Barry



    This is mostly his JB7 Rock & Roll years stuff and just about has a tenuous link to be on the NP thread due to the inclusion of two tracks from BEAT GIRL, one from NEVER LET GO and the track Hit & Miss which was the long running theme for BBC pop quiz show JUKE BOX JURY, this compilation also includes Barry singing, and though his voice isn't that bad, I can understand why he wished he could personally get hold of every copy and destroy them. wink
